Lange Lacke is the largest of over 40 saline lakes in the Burgenland Seewinkel, located within the Neusiedler See-Seewinkel National Park in Austria. This region is characterized by shallow, fluctuating lakes, extensive meadows, steppes, and wetlands. It is recognized for its unique biodiversity and as an internationally significant bird sanctuary.

The region is excellent for cycling, with over 1,000 kilometers (620 miles) of cycling paths in the broader Lake Neusiedl area. The Lake Neusiedl Cycle Path (B10) is a popular 117.5 kilometer (73 mile) route. For more options, explore the Cycling around Lange Lacke guide.

Lange Lacke is known for its unique saline lakes, which can fluctuate significantly in size and sometimes dry out completely, leaving salt deserts. The region is a paradise for water bird species and features extensive grazed meadows, steppes, and wetlands. It also contains the lowest measured point in Austria, at 114 meters (374 feet) above sea level.
